This course gives an introduction to the use of CAN buses and LIN buses in automotive applications. It is a
practical course designed to teach students the basics of CAN and LIN bus connections and voltages, and it
also teaches students how to debug faults in CAN and LIN systems.

The course makes use of the Matrix CAN bus system: this consists of 6 educational Electronic Control Units
and accompanying Locktronics boards which mimic the electrical system in a vehicle. The system includes 3
CAN bus networks at different speeds, a LIN bus and a Gateway ECU which provides communication between
the system and OBDII scan tools.

The CAN and LIN bus system can be enhanced through the addition of real automotive sensors that are
added to the system.
